The head of steam built up by AT's light rail project team was lost when the government transferred the work to NZTA - a government agency with no experience in rapid transit. Supplied Auckland mayor Phil Goff and Transport Minister Phil Twyford at the construction start of City Rail Link's Aotea Station, a day before the suspension of Light Rail was announced. The contrast is the transformative City Rail Link project, a pair of $4.5 billion rail tunnels under the city centre, now well underway.
